The Sludge Transfer Rotary Lobe Pump is a positive displacement pump specifically designed for the transfer of viscous, abrasive, and solid-laden fluids such as sludge, slurry, and wastewater. Its robust stainless steel or cast iron construction, combined with precise lobe technology, ensures consistent performance, high efficiency, and long service life — even in the toughest industrial environments.
Unlike centrifugal pumps, rotary lobe pumps maintain a constant flow regardless of pressure variations, making them ideal for handling thick, non-Newtonian materials with high solid content. This makes them a preferred choice for wastewater treatment, biogas plants, chemical industries, and food waste management systems.
The sludge transfer rotary lobe pump operates using two synchronized lobes that rotate in opposite directions within the pump casing. As the lobes rotate, cavities are formed between the lobes and the casing wall. These cavities trap the fluid and move it smoothly from the inlet to the outlet side of the pump.
Inlet: The suction action draws sludge or slurry into the pump chamber.
Transfer: The rotating lobes transport the medium without pulsation or turbulence.
Discharge: The sludge is expelled under steady pressure at the outlet.
Because the lobes never come into direct contact, internal wear is minimized, ensuring smooth, low-shear pumping that protects the integrity of the pumped medium.

When selecting a rotary lobe pump for sludge applications, consider the following parameters:
Flow Rate & Pressure: Determine the required flow capacity and discharge pressure based on your system design.
Sludge Viscosity & Solids Content: Higher solids or thicker sludge may require lower speed and larger displacement lobes.
Material Compatibility: Choose the right pump material to resist corrosion and abrasion.
Seal Type: Mechanical seals are ideal for clean sludge; packing seals are more economical for dirty or abrasive media.
Drive System: Select between electric, diesel, or hydraulic drives depending on your installation environment.
Installation Type: Fixed base, mobile trolley, or skid-mounted versions are available to meet various operational needs.
